Abstract
A novel manganese-catalyzed C-H activation methodology for selective hydrogen isotope exchange of benzaldehydes is presented. Using D2O as a cheap and convenient source of deuterium, the reaction proceeds with excellent functional group tolerance. High ortho-selectivity is achieved in the presence of catalytic amounts of specific amines, which in situ form a transient directing group.Entities:
